Rules for Squirt, Atom, PeeWee

We will be playing by all official soccer rules with the following changes:

* In U5 and U8, each team shall have no more than 7 players on the field, one
(1) of whom shall be the goalkeeper. In U10 each team shall have no more than 9 players, one (1) of whom is a goalkeeper. In U12 and U14 each team shall have no more than 11 players, one (1) of whom is a goalkeeper.

* To start the game there must be at least 6 players on each team for U5, U8, U10 and at least 8 for U12 and U14. If the required number of players is not present the game shall be cancelled and both teams will have a practice.

* Teams will choose ends to start the game and switch at half time.

* Each team shall be allowed unlimited substitutions at stoppages of play, under the control of the referee.

* The game shall be divided into two equal halves with a 5 minute half-time break. In U12 and U14 there shall be a 5 minute warm up before the game, and the halves shall be 25 minutes each. In U8 and U10 there shall be a 10 minute warm up practice, and the halves shall be 20 minutes each.

* There will be no offsides for U8 and U10.

* There will be NO crease rule. Players shall be allowed to kick the ball anywhere on the playing field including the goal area.

* The referee shall be the sole judqe as to fouls intentionally committed during the game, resulting in free-kick or penalty kick.

* U12 and U14 coaches are NOT allowed on the field (except for emergency situations) during the game. They will be able to walk along the side line of their own half field.
